It’s beginning, Ron Vlaar is linked with moves away from Villa Park. Vlaar has been called up and has featured in all 3 of Netherlands World Cup games. In each 3 games he has impressed and has been an absolute rock at the back. Now, we should be supporting Vlaar since he really is Villa’s best representative at this years World Cup. But, with Vlaar’s contract expiring next season and no really progress made towards extending his contract, I’m sure that some Villa fans (like myself) are beginning to worry that we might lose our captain and best defensive player.
QPR is the first team linked with Ron Vlaar, honestly QPR appear to be linked with anyone so I wouldn’t look too much into it. Besides, joining QPR would be a step down. The biggest fear could possibly be from Manchester United, Luis Van Gaal is a fan of Vlaar and he might be tempted to bring Vlaar to Manchester United. There have been reports that Vlaar doesn’t feel wanted at Villa after the club failed to offer him a new deal and has recently criticised Aston Villa’s drinking culture. I think he’s slowly becoming fed up, he knows that he is aging and may look into taking the opportunity to move to a ‘big’ club while his stock is high. If he does decide to stay at Villa, the club will have to offer him a massive pay increase.
